Alexey Pesoshin: The Republic of Cuba is one of the most important foreign economic partners of Tatarstan

23 May 2017, Tuesday

On May 23, at his meeting with Cuban Ambassador to Russia Emilio Lozada García in the Government House of the republic, Tatarstan Prime Minister Alexey Pesoshin said that the Republic of Cuba is one of the most importance foreign economic partners of Tatarstan.

He thanked the Ambassador for his interest in Tatarstan and the desire to develop trade, economic and investment cooperation.

Pesoshin said that Tatarstan is interested in expanding the range and volume of trade with Cuba.

Considerable progress was achieved in this work in 2016, when foreign trade turnover between the two republics made 100.6 million US dollars. As compared to 2015, this figure was 11.3 million US dollars.

Pesoshin stressed that Cuba is one of the most stable and promising markets for the Kazan Helicopter Plant and KAMAZ Automaker (Naberezhney Chelny).

Among other promising areas of cooperation, Prime Minister of Tatarstan called cooperation in the field of health, sports and tourism.

In his turn García noted that the relations between Tatarstan and Cuba are developing fruitfully. He reminded that in 1996, when Cuba had a tough time, the Republic of Tatarstan opened its trade and economic representative office on the island of Liberty. "We will never forget this. This event has become one of the most important in the history of our relations,” the Ambassador said.

Aide to Prime Minister of Tatarstan Nazil Nasibullin, Minister of Health of the republic Adel Vafin, Director General of Export Corporation of the Republic of Tatarstan Airat Nazmiev and other officials took part in the meeting.
